Jan 4th 2011:- eCardio is scheduled to participate in the Digital Health Summit at the 2011 International CES at the Las Vegas Convention Center. eCardio Vice President of Information Technology, Andrew Arroyo, will be contributing in a discussion panel titled The Role of Remote Monitoring in Digital Healthcare Systems on January 7, 2011 at 10:30 a.m. PST.

The Digital Health Summit at the 2011 Consumer Electronics Show will focus on the booming market of consumer-based health and wellness innovations that combine technology and healthcare. In addition to diagnosing and battling disease, today’s generation of high-tech healthcare products and services will be the catalyst for better managed healthcare. The panel will introduce new technologies crucial for managing care and will address how telehealth devices and communication technologies are putting consumers in the driver’s seat.
